Supply cable fuses
Fuses for short circuit protection of the supply cable are listed below. The fuses also
protect the adjoining equipment of the drive in case of a short circuit.
Check that the operating time of the fuse is below 0.5 seconds. The operating time
depends on the supply network impedance and the cross-sectional area and length
of the supply cable. See also chapter Planning the electrical installation on page 55.
Note: Fuses with a higher current rating must not be used.
Drive type
ACS880-M04
Input
current
(A)
IEC fuse UL fuse Cross-sectional
area of cable
Rated
current
(A)
Volt-
age
(V)
Class Rated
current
(A)
Volt-
age
(V)
UL
class
mm
2
AWG
-03A0-2, -03A0-5 4.0* 6 500 gG 6 600 T 1.5…4 16…12
-03A6-2, -03A6-5 6.0* 6 500 gG 6 600 T 1.5…4 16…12
-04A8-2, -04A8-5 7.0* 10 500 gG 10 600 T 1.5…4 16…12
-06A0-2, -06A0-5 9.0* 10 500 gG 10 600 T 1.5…4 16…12
-08A0-2, -08A0-5 11* 16 500 gG 15 600 T 1.5…4 16…12
-010A-2, -010A-5 13* 16 500 gG 15 600 T 1.5…10 16…8
-014A-2, -014A-5 18* 20 500 gG 20 600 T 1.5 0 16…8
-018A-2, -018A-5 23* 25 500 gG 25 600 T 1.5…10 16…8
-025A-2, -025A-5 20 25 500 gG 25 600 T 6…35 9…2
-030A-2, -030A-5 26 32 500 gG 35 600 T 6…35 9…2
-035A-2, -035A-5 30 40 500 gG 35 600 T 6…35 9…2
-044A-2, -044A-5 36 50 500 gG 45 600 T 6…35 9…2
-050A-2, -050A-5 42 50 500 gG 50 600 T 10…70 6…2/0
-061A-2, -061A-5 55 63 500 gG 70 600 T 10…70 6…2/0
-078A-2, -078A-5 65 80 500 gG 80 600 T 10…70 6…2/0
-094A-2, -094A-5 82 100 500 gG 100 600 T 10…70 6…2/0
*Without mains choke
AWG cable sizing is based on NEC Table 310-16 for copper wires, 75 °C (167 °F) wire insulation at 40 °C
(104 °F) surrounding air temperature. Not more than three current-carrying conductors in raceway or cable
or earth (directly burried). For other conditions, dimension the cables according to local safety regulations,
appropriate input voltage and the load current of the drive.
